Export to PDF add-in for Office 2007 allows you to create PDFs from any Office document for free…

Microsoft has a free add-in for the Office 2007 suite that allows you to export any office document to PDF. You just need to download the add-in from here and install it. You will then see an option to “Save As” PDF from the "Save As” menu.

Sharing your calendar with a mobile workforce…

With Outlook and Microsoft Exchange server it is possible to share your calendar and view others’ shared calendars in your organization. Here is a video demonstration on how exactly to do this.
